>   It is very easy to stop Skype from saying Skype has new window.  Just
>   go into preferences, then go to notifications and disable all visual
>   alerts.  You can also have Skype tell you when contacts are available
>   by choosing the contacts available event under notifications.  Then
>   just check the box that says speak text.
